Apabila bekerja dengan halaman web yang panjang pada Safari mudah alih, adalah wajar untuk menghalang pengguna daripada menatal melepasi kandungan awal yang boleh dilihat. Walau bagaimanapun, menggunakan overflow:hidden pada
elemen tidak selalu mencapai kesan ini pada platform tertentu ini.Untuk menyelesaikan isu ini, penyelesaian yang terbukti berkesan ialah menggunakan overflow:hidden pada kedua-dua elemen html dan badan. Pendekatan ini berkesan mengawal tingkah laku menatal pada Safari mudah alih:
html, body { overflow: hidden; }
Walau bagaimanapun, jika anda menggunakan iOS 9 secara khusus, anda mungkin mengalami sedikit variasi dalam kod yang diperlukan:
html, body { overflow: hidden; position: relative; height: 100%; }
Pelarasan ini memastikan bahawa penatalan dilumpuhkan di luar bahagian halaman yang kelihatan pada Safari mudah alih, membolehkan anda mencapai reka letak dan pengguna yang diingini pengalaman.
Atas ialah kandungan terperinci Bagaimana untuk Melumpuhkan Tatal dengan Berkesan dalam Safari Mudah Alih?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!